3100871 " Excuse me, Sir!", 18 October 1813 (colour litho) by Job, pseudonym for Onfray de Breville, Jacques (1858-1931); Private Collection; (add.info.: " Excuse me, Sir!", 18 October 1813. Napoleon offers one of his soldiers a pinch of snuff during the Battle of Leipzig. Illustration for Le Grand Napoleon des Petits Enfants par Job et J de Marthold (Plon-Nourrit, 1893).); © Look and Learn

captures a poignant moment during the Battle of Leipzig on 18 October 1813. In this color lithograph by Job (pseudonym for Onfray de Breville), we witness Napoleon Bonaparte offering one of his soldiers a pinch of snuff amidst the chaos and violence of war. The image is part of the collection "Le Grand Napoleon des Petits Enfants par Job et J de Marthold" published in 1893. It provides a glimpse into the life and character of Napoleon, showcasing his empathy and connection with his troops even in the midst of battle. Napoleon, dressed in his iconic uniform and hat, stands tall as he extends his hand towards the soldier. The soldier, wearing a greatcoat that bears witness to the harsh conditions they face, looks up at their leader with gratitude and respect.
